Understanding the German Medical Retail Landscape
Unlike some nations where medical materials can be bought wholesale at large, basic outlet store, Germany keeps a strict difference between general retail and medical retail. Medical gadgets, prescription medications, specialized orthopedic supports, and rehabilitation equipment are distributed through managed channels to make sure patient security and expert oversight.

What Can You Find at a German Sanitätshaus?
A Sanitätshaus is the closest comparable to a devoted "Medic Store" in Germany. These shops are gold mine of health and movement services. They bridge the gap in between medical care and everyday living, offering items designed to aid recovery, improve movement, and improve the quality of life for individuals with chronic conditions or injuries.

Among the most essential aspects of buying medical materials in Germany is understanding how the public or personal medical insurance systems communicate with these stores.
In Germany, lots of medical gadgets-- ranging from crutches and wheelchairs to compression stockings-- are categorized as Hilfsmittel (assistive medical gadgets). If a doctor composes a prescription (Rezept) for a particular medical help, a considerable portion-- or in some cases the totality-- of the expense might be covered by your health insurance coverage.

Keep in mind: Patients usually need to pay a little statutory co-payment (Zuzahlung), which usually ranges from EUR5 to EUR10 per item, unless they are formally exempt.
